    Ipswich Town VS Arsenal ✅💯 Ipswich Town welcome Premier League champions Arsenal to Portman Road this Tuesday in an EFL Cup third-round tie. Ipswich defeated Leicester to earn this opportunity to knock out Arsenal, who were last season's beaten finalists in this competition. Current Performance Ipswich Town: Ipswich arrive with confidence after a dramatic 3-2 away win over Crystal Palace, following defeats to Liverpool and Manchester United and victories over Leicester City in the previous Carabao Cup round and Sunderland in the Premier League. Their results show attacking danger in open, transitional matches, but the heavy losses also expose defensive weaknesses Arsenal could exploit.

      Ipswich has been in good form recently, winning 7 out of their last 10 games across all competitions. At home, they've had an excellent record, winning 4 out of their last 5 games with an average of over 2 goals per game. In the last Premier League match, they secured a 3-2 victory over Crystal Palace, showing great resilience in adversity. However, Ipswich also has some core weaknesses. In the first 4 rounds of the Premier League this season, they conceded 10 goals, with an average of 2.5 goals per game. Their defense lacks stability when facing strong teams' high - pressure attacks. In the last two games against Manchester United and Liverpool, they conceded a total of 7 goals. There are also some changes in the lineup. The main striker, Emerson (who scored 2 goals in 4 games this season), is likely to be rested. The midfielder, Jack Taylor, is out for a long - term due to a knee injury. It will be difficult for the substitute Fleming to pose a continuous threat to Arsenal's goal.

      Arsenal's current form is highly commendable. They've started the new Premier League season with an impressive four - game winning streak, leading the league standings. In the previous match, they shut out Sunderland 2 - 0 away from home. In their last five official games, they've achieved four wins and one draw, showing stability both in attack and defense. With only nine goals conceded in their last ten matches, their defensive efficiency far surpasses that of their upcoming opponent. On the other hand, Ipswich has its own strengths. Although they are generally considered the underdog against Arsenal, they are full of fighting spirit when playing at home. In their last Premier League game, they won 3 - 2 against Crystal Palace away from home, breaking a 32 - game winless streak when conceding the first goal.
